I got a chance to check out the new Fan Expo earlier today in Vancouver. Crazy crowds today; amazing energy! It was basically Halloween hits downtown given all the great superhero costumes.

The check in process was quite brutal though; especially for those ppl that had to wait 2-3 hours in the early morning to get in. But overall it sounds like the usual growing pains for a first-time event. The retailers seemed really happy with their respective sales. And quite a few celebrity personalities (more than i expected) in addition to your usual batch of artists/writers.

My son and his friend enjoyed the selection of toys & hobby cards. For me, i managed to pick up a couple of Marvel variants, both of which I got signed by one of my fave writers...Greg Rucka!
